Summary
In this conversation, S Anthony Thomas shares personal stories of betrayal from friends, illustrating the pain of being lied to by those we trust. He recounts two significant experiences: one from childhood involving a friend who stole his prized football players, and another from his adult life in sales where a colleague attempted to steal a client. Through these narratives, he explores themes of trust, friendship, and the impact of betrayal on personal relationships. Ultimately, he emphasizes the importance of moving on from those who lie and making space for genuine connections.
